Douglas Henry "Doug" Delsemme

January 2, 1943 — August 14, 2025

Kansas City

Douglas Henry Delsemme, 82, passed away on Thursday, August 14, 2025.

A mountain man, art enthusiast (with a special appreciation for David Wright), history buff, lover of literature, and devoted Bob Dylan fan, Doug was known for his sharp humor, legal acumen, and escapist mentality.

Doug’s audacious spirit started on Long Island in his hometown of Lynbrook, New York. He dreamt of a new life on new terrain. Kansas was calling.

Doug studied history at Baker University and was a member of Sigma Phi Epsilon Fraternity. He received his law degree from The University of Kansas, which launched him into a devoted career as VP and General Counsel for Hodgdon Powder Company, Inc.

Doug shared wilderness journeys, cultural commentary, Bob Seger concerts, and endless laughs with his two children, Carrie and Jeff. He explored the world on a motorcycle seat or horseback (although Doug often preferred mule-back) and visited an enviable list of destinations.

Doug will continue his adventures and storytelling with his son Jeffery Alexis Delsemme (1969-2013) and granddaughter Dorothy Lenz Delsemme (2001). He also joins his mother Edna Katherine Delsemme and father Henry Alexis Delsemme.

Those left behind cherishing Doug’s tales are his daughter Carrie Miller and her husband John; granddaughter Ava Lenz Delsemme; and daughter-in-law Deborah Dorothy Delsemme. He also leaves behind a community of artists and adventurers that will keep the memories of a beloved historian, storyteller, and friend alive.

In lieu of flowers, donations can be made to the Contemporary Longrifle Foundation (CLF) in which Doug was a longtime board member.

“I don't know where I'm going, but I know it won't be boring" - Bob Dylan
